Best for what? Style, durability or cost?
We went with best for cost and being neurotic 1st time parents, we NEEDED to have a perfectly matching brand new nursery. Silly in hindsight, but most things are.
So we went with the Storkcraft Aspen crib, changing table & dresser through Walmart online. Target & Babies R’ Us carried the same set, but Walmart was the least expensive. And we got furniture that reflects the price. Crappy all around.
We should have checked consignment shops, newspaper ads, ebay or craigslist. I’ve become a bit crafty since becoming a mommy and I would’ve loved putting my own spin on the baby furniture.
